Your Role as a Float Nurse:

As our float Dental Nurse, you'll be the dependable, go-to team member covering where needed—whether that's chairside with our Implantologist, supporting hygiene sessions, jumping into decontamination, or filling in during sickness and holidays. Your day-to-day might look different, but one thing is constant: you'll be central to keeping the clinical environment running smoothly.

Your responsibilities include:
  • Supporting a range of clinicians including general dentists, hygienists, implantologists, and orthodontists.
  • Chairside nursing for routine and specialist procedures, including Implants, Endo, Orthodontics, and Facial Aesthetics.
  • Maintaining impeccable cross-infection control and decontamination standards.
  • Efficiently preparing treatment rooms, instruments, and equipment.
  • Occasionally stepping in at reception – strong admin and communication skills are essential.
  • Upholding excellent patient care and communication, especially in fast-paced or changing environments.
